Sun. Airflow. Layout. Materiality. Get these right and performance follows.
Hope & Autumn homes have been designed to achieve an 8.4-star NatHERS energy rating — using around half the energy of a standard 6-star home.

50 Queen marks Up’s first step into Melbourne’s CBD — and we’re committed to contributing more than just a building.
Recently, our team volunteered with @thebigumbrella , preparing Feed Melbourne meals from rescued food and Urban Farm produce at Federation Square. Because while development shapes skylines, real impact happens on the ground.

A place is at its best when its community feels a sense of ownership.
Together with the green thumbs at @cultivatingcommunity , Morris Moor has installed a series of wicking beds that will soon be home to leafy greens and fresh herbs – ready for tenants to tuck into sandwiches, sprinkle over salads, or share around the office kitchen.

In true boundary-pushing style, we’ve redefined townhouse living. Arc Highton is a boutique collection of 19 single- and double-storey residences — offering a truly independent lifestyle grounded in architectural distinction, generous proportions and a deeper sense of community.
Construction has commenced and homes are now selling.
